Pseudotropheus Greshakei Malawi African Cichlid

“Known for its vibrant electric blue coloring, the Pseudotropheus Greshakei Malawi African Cichlid is a striking addition to any aquarium. Originating from the rocky shores of Lake Malawi in Africa, this species thrives in freshwater environments. Their diet primarily consists of high-quality cichlid pellets supplemented with occasional treats of live or frozen foods like brine shrimp or bloodworms.

In community tanks, it’s best to house them with other Lake Malawi cichlids, preferably those of similar size and temperament to prevent aggression. The Greshakei Malawi Cichlid exhibits moderate territorial behavior, especially during breeding periods, so providing ample hiding spaces among rocks or caves is beneficial.

Due to their territorial nature, it’s recommended for aquarists with some experience in managing cichlid behavior to care for them. These fish thrive in water temperatures around 76-82°F (24-28°C) with a pH level of 7.5-8.5, mimicking their natural habitat for optimal health and coloration. With proper care and a suitable tank setup, these cichlids add both beauty and dynamic behavior to an aquarium.”

We operate a UK wide next day delivery service available through DX overnight, a DEFRA registered courier. All our fish are packed in double thickness bags for safety and filled with pure oxygen. The bags are then wrapped in a foil blanket with heat packs to keep them warm. They are then packed in a large polystyrene box with a cardboard outer. All our fish are booked with the courier as “live fish” and travel in security cages throughout their journey. All fish are only in the box for a maximum of 18 hours which is our service level agreement with the courier.
